➤ Led multi-disciplined subsurface team to successfully execute a complex exploration program targeting the unconventional Canol shale in a remote frontier basin. Program was completed safely, on time and on budget with all technical objectives met. Exploration program consisted of 2 vertical data acquisition wells 2012/2013 winter and 2 Canol Hz wells with multi-stage hydraulic fracturing operations 2013/2014 winter. A first in northern Canadian history.➤ Was responsible for the submission of a Significant Discovery Declaration to the National Energy Board and received a Significant Discovery License of the entire application area (307 sections) held in perpetuity.➤ Stakeholder Engagement – Worked with the stakeholder engagement team to conduct extensive consultation with both regulators and communities to gain approval for exploration program. Point of contact for the Central Mackenzie Valley media requests (CBC, Globe and Mail, Up Here Business, Wall Street Journal, Bloomberg, etc.).➤ Presented and sat on a panel at the Canadian Arctic Oil and Gas Symposium (2013 and 2014), presented at the Inuvik Petroleum Show (2014), presented at the Unconventional Reservoirs Symposium ConocoPhillips Houston (2014).

➤ Two key responsibilities: Team lead of regional onshore Mackenzie Delta exploration team and geologist for the Amauligak Field in the Beaufort Sea. Team Lead - Directed and helped a group of geoscientists tasked with exploring the Mackenzie Delta Onshore area for another anchor sized field. By providing mentorship, setting clear goals, breaking the work load up into manageable pieces and by supporting one another, the Team successfully reviewed and summarized the hydrocarbon potential of the area and presented these findings to senior Houston exploration management.➤ Amauligak Field – Provided the geology input to the initial geomodel, clearly communicated with management about geological risk and uncertainties and helped create the subsurface FEL-1 schedule for Amauligak. Geomodel was completed and peer reviewed by both senior Houston exploration staff and field partner Chevron. An increase of in-place resource of 33% (~476 mmbbl) over previous 2003 numbers. Thin bed effects and calibrated petrophysical model were the major factors for the increase in resource numbers.

➤ Play Geologist responsible for a number of properties in northeast British Columbia and Alberta. ➤ Lapp property (94-H-10) Triassic Halfway exploration and development. Five wells in Q1 2001, New Pool Wildcat discovered, and designated the Halfway ‘D’ Pool, 2.5 mmbl OOIP. Six development wells in Q1 2002.➤ Sundown Field (93-P-7) Cadotte exploration. 2 exploration wells drilled in Q1 2002.➤ Talbot Lake Property, Twp 94-96, R 9-11. Bluesky exploration and development. Q1 2001 – 13 wells drilled. ➤ Valhalla, Twp 75-80, R 1-13. Doe Creek development. Q3 2001 – 12 wells drilled, mixture of producers and injectors.
